An AI gym environment and game engine for building, training, testing, and comparing Agents in different types of environments.
An AI gym environment and game engine for building, testing, and comparing Agents in different environments.

Mission and Vision

The mission of IGEEK is to make it easier to build, test, and compare AI Agents from bare-metal to the Cloud. The vision of IGEEK is to create a portable robotics simulator that can also be used for games and scientific computing.


IGEEK is built with Script2, Kabuki Toolkit, and Kabuki Tek Toolkit. Currently this repo has no work done on it, but there has been a moderate amount of work done on igeek.human in Java that was never ported, but we're using SFML now. The projects we're going to be working on in the Astartup Live-stream are.

  1. igeek.human - An abstract simulation of the Human immune system with robotic white blood cells that fight off genetically modified viruses.
  2. igeek.bock_world - A Modern Embedded-C++ port of STB's Voxel rendering engine in Script2.
  3. igeek.tile_world - A 2D tile game engine.
  4. igeek.rpg_toolkit - A role-playing game IGEEK extension.
  5. igeek.autopilot - An autopilot for IGEEK environments.
  6. igeek.ulator - An IMUL graphing Calculator IGEEK extension.


Copyright © 2019 Kabuki Starship™.

This Source Code Form is subject to the terms of the Mozilla Public License, v. 2.0. If a copy of the MPL was not distributed with this file, You can obtain one at

